diff options
author | H.J. Lu <hjl.tools@gmail.com> | 2006-11-08 19:56:02 +0000 |
---|---|---|
committer | H.J. Lu <hjl.tools@gmail.com> | 2006-11-08 19:56:02 +0000 |
commit | b7d9ef3748b9726f59df95eae857417166cc0fde (patch) | |
tree | 6440115f50292392b3344d0b460f64ae29ea6e08 /gas/config/tc-i386.h | |
parent | 3c9f59e48f6ec6d7598dd566c522709c58022e2b (diff) | |
download | binutils-gdb-b7d9ef3748b9726f59df95eae857417166cc0fde.tar.gz |
gas/
2006-11-08 H.J. Lu <hongjiu.lu@intel.com>
* config/tc-i386.h (CpuPNI): Removed.
(CpuUnknownFlags): Replace CpuPNI with CpuSSE3.
* config/tc-i386.c (md_assemble): Likewise.
include/opcode/
2006-11-08 H.J. Lu <hongjiu.lu@intel.com>
* i386.h (i386_optab): Replace CpuPNI with CpuSSE3.
Diffstat (limited to 'gas/config/tc-i386.h')
-rw-r--r-- | gas/config/tc-i386.h | 3 |
1 files changed, 1 insertions, 2 deletions
diff --git a/gas/config/tc-i386.h b/gas/config/tc-i386.h index d0893f90f6f..0d42e1b86f2 100644 --- a/gas/config/tc-i386.h +++ b/gas/config/tc-i386.h @@ -183,7 +183,6 @@ typedef struct #define Cpu3dnow 0x2000 /* 3dnow! support required */ #define Cpu3dnowA 0x4000 /* 3dnow!Extensions support required */ #define CpuSSE3 0x8000 /* Streaming SIMD extensions 3 required */ -#define CpuPNI CpuSSE3 /* Prescott New Instructions required */ #define CpuPadLock 0x10000 /* VIA PadLock required */ #define CpuSVME 0x20000 /* AMD Secure Virtual Machine Ext-s required */ #define CpuVMX 0x40000 /* VMX Instructions required */ @@ -197,7 +196,7 @@ typedef struct /* The default value for unknown CPUs - enable all features to avoid problems. */ #define CpuUnknownFlags (Cpu186|Cpu286|Cpu386|Cpu486|Cpu586|Cpu686 \ - |CpuP4|CpuSledgehammer|CpuMMX|CpuMMX2|CpuSSE|CpuSSE2|CpuPNI|CpuVMX \ + |CpuP4|CpuSledgehammer|CpuMMX|CpuMMX2|CpuSSE|CpuSSE2|CpuSSE3|CpuVMX \ |Cpu3dnow|Cpu3dnowA|CpuK6|CpuPadLock|CpuSVME|CpuSSSE3|CpuABM|CpuSSE4a) /* the bits in opcode_modifier are used to generate the final opcode from |